Unit 7 Alcohols Phenols and Ethers MCQ Questions Class 12 Chemistry with Answers

Question: Catalytic dehydrogenation of a primary alcohol gives a
a) Ketone
b) Aldehyde
c) Sec. alcohol
d) Ester
Answer: b

Question: Which chemical is used to distinguish between phenol and benzyl alcohol?
a) NaHCO₃
b) FeCl₃
c) Iodoform test
d) none of the above
Answer: b

Question: Which of the following is more acidic than alcohol?
a) Phenol
b) Cyclohexanol
c) Benzyl alcohol
d) Ethenol
Answer: a

Question: On heating aqueous solution of benzene diazonium chloride, which compound is formed?
a) Benzene
b) Chloro benzene
c) Phenol
d) Aniline
Answer: c

Question: What is the IUPAC name of Vinyl alcohol?
a) Ethanol
b) Methanol
c) Ethenol
d) Methenol
Answer: c

Question: The reaction of carboxylic acid and alcohol catalysed by conc. H₂SO₄ is called—
a) Dehydration
b) Saponification
c) Esterification
d) Neutralisation
Answer: c

Question: Which compound is obtained by dehydrogenation of secondary alcohols?
a) Ketone
b) Aldehyde
c) Carboxylic acid
d) Amine
Answer: a

Question: Name a compound which can be used as an anesthetic in surgery ?
Answer. Ethrane

Question: In Williamson synthesis , which type of halide should not be used ?
Answer. Tertiary alkylhalide

VERY SHORT ANSWER TYPE QUESTIONS

Question: Why phenol is acidic in nature ?
Answer. Due to stability of phenoxide ion by resonance.

Question: Among HI, HBr and HCl, HI is most reactive towards alcohols. Why ?
Answer. Due to lowest bond dissociation energy of HI.

Question: Name a compound which is used as antiseptic as well as disinfectant.
Answer. Solution of phenol : 0.2% antiseptic, 2% disinfectant.

Question: What is nitrating mixture ?
Answer. Conc. (H2SO4 + HNO3)

Question: Lower alcohols are soluble in water, higher alcohols are not. Why ?
Answer. Due to formation of hydrogen bonds.

Question: Ethanol has higher boiling point than methoxy methane. Give reason.
Answer. Because of H-bonds.

Question: Which of the following isomer is more volatile :
o-nitrophenol or p-nitrophenol
Answer. o-nitrophenol.
